People said that if you don't go to Kashgar, you can't say that you have been to Xinjiang. So what's special with Kashgar, and are the Xinjiang people hospitable enough to welcome guests from around the world? What about the grapes?
go2c answered at 4 months ago
Kashgar is a very beautiful place with four distinctive seasons, so it is cool in summers and warm in winters. The annual average temperature is 11.8 degree Celsius, and the annual sunshine is about 2652 hours. Kashgar is quite different from the other regions of China. Bustling bazaars are filled with veiled Muslim women and animated central traders. Solemn mosque stands out among thatched-houses. And Xinjiang people is very hospitable, guests will be served with tasty food and fresh fruits. Due to the weather in Xinjiang, the grapes there are quite delicious, you should have a taste of them.
